Neurological office is seeking intelligent, driven and reliable candidates. Patient Care Representatives serve as the initial person to greet, instruct and direct all patients visiting the office-utilizing skills of tact, drive and confidentiality in a professional manner.
Must be: Enthusiastic, flexible, reliable, friendly, hardworking and detail oriented.
Patient Care Representatives are expected to follow the daily protocols of the practice. You are expected to represent our company keeping our vision at the forefront of each patient interaction.
The job duties are as follows:
- Check in / Check Out patients verify and update all demographic and insurance information and collection of co-payments resulting in proper cash reconciliation.
- Verify patient insurance and referrals available.
- Maintain appointment computer scheduling in accordance with office scheduling policies.
- Prepping demographics and charts for upcoming appointments.
- Utilizing a multi-line phone system, fax machine, printer, copier, and scanner to process patients through check in/checkout process.
- Answering Multi-Phone Lines, Faxing, Scanning Documentation and Completing Daily Patient phone messages and callbacks.
- Scheduling/organizing diagnostic tests, transition of cares, follow up appointments for patients.
- Contacting / interacting with appropriate facilities, such as hospitals, rehabilitation centers, assisted living facilities, etc. in regards to Patient Care.
- Pulling tests as required for an assigned physician, or as a back-up to another co-worker.
- Perform administrative support as required.
- Other duties as assigned by managers and leads.
